Description The Department of Biology at Emory University invites applications for an Assistant Teaching Professor position Faculty appointments will be made at the Assistant Teaching Professor level. Established over 25 years ago, the teaching track in Emory College is one of the strongest and longest-running in the country. This position will involve working with second-semester introductory biology labs in training a team of lab instructors and collaborating with the first-semester lab coordinator as well as the support of two full-time staff for material preparation. In addition to teaching, commonly four courses per year, successful applicants will be expected to contribute to the academic life and governance of the Biology Department, College of Arts and Sciences, and the University. The appointee will join a cohesive group of tenure-track (25) and teaching-track (14) faculty working collaboratively in the teaching, research, and service missions of Emory University. Department of Biology faculty are committed to creating a respectful community of educators and scholars and seek colleagues who are eager to nurture and support growth of students, staff, and faculty.
